According to Swedish master florist Per Benjamin, floral art is all about emotions. Bringing flowers to the people is translating and communicating emotions, is showing them that the future has always something good and beautiful to offer.

In this book he shares his personal ideas about flowers and creativity. His unstoppable curiosity is his driving force and allows him to find new materials as well as new ways to use the old ones. Per Benjamin is without a doubt one of the greatest ‘technicians’ in the world of floristry. In this book he shows a wide range of arrangements, from the well known playful and colourful, almost kitschy pieces to the more natural transparent, discrete ones. However, they always manage quite easily to draw one’s attention in an elegant, charming way. This updated and revised edition of his very successful monograph Elements (2004) demonstrates how his pieces have stood the test of time and are still very refreshing and relevant.

Why did Per produce a new edition of his book?

” First of all because the original book was sold out and there was still general demand for it. However I did not feel like merely producing a reprint: I wanted to do more than that and add my thoughts and ideas on what has happened during these 15 years and show a mix of both old and new designs. What strikes me is how manu of these “old” designs  are very contemporary, even today, and could have been made by me very recently! So I have saved those and added new ones to show who I am as a designer in 2019.”
